## Fabrikit Environments

Fabrikit, our test-data factory library, is exercised in three environments: dev, staging, and release-candidate. Release builds must pass the factory determinism suite in staging before tagging. Seed data is regenerated nightly; staging mirrors production schemas with scrubbed values. The release manager signs off on the RC run. Staging currently loads the following configuration.

settings of tagef-bawif:
DRUIX_HOST=druix.zemvarlabs.internal
DRUIX_PORT=8000

Capacity note for Hooksmith delivery workers: retries are the dominant load factor, not first attempts. A receiver outage turns every pending delivery into a retry stream, so queue depth scales with backoff shape rather than raw event volume. We cap attempts, apply jittered exponential backoff, and park exhausted deliveries in a dead-letter table rather than looping forever. Worker pool sizing in this review assumes those semantics hold. The retry schedule and concurrency limits are defined by the constants below.

tuning table, kajog-kawef:
PRIORITIES = {
    "kelox": 870,
    "kasix": 89,
    "eliax": 988,
}

Ticket #— Floor 9 Opening Prep, Brindlemoor House

Hi facilities folks, Floor 9 opens to staff next Monday and we need a few things squared away before then. Lift access is live, but the two side doors by the kitchenette are still on the old lock config — please reprogram them before Friday. Also, signage for the quiet rooms hasn't arrived, so pop up the temporary printed ones for now. Until the badge readers sync, the interim door code for Floor 9 is below.

door code, bajop-bajog: bdg-DSWAC-43621